Question

Four letter-clusters have been given, out of which three are alike in some manner and one is different. Select the letter-cluster that is different.

The correct answer is

ZAEJ

Find the Different Letter Cluster: Odd One Out Analysis

This question asks us to identify the letter cluster that does not follow the same pattern as the other three. We can solve this type of verbal reasoning problem by looking at the positional values of the letters in the English alphabet and finding a relationship or rule between consecutive letters within each cluster.

Analyzing Each Letter Cluster to Find the Pattern

Let's examine the pattern in each given letter cluster by using the positional value of each letter (A=1, B=2, ..., Z=26). We will look at the difference in positional values between consecutive letters in each cluster.

1. BDHN

  • B is the 2nd letter.
  • D is the 4th letter.
  • H is the 8th letter.
  • N is the 14th letter.

Let's check the difference between consecutive letters:

  • From B to D: The difference in positional value is $4 - 2 = 2$. (Add 2)
  • From D to H: The difference in positional value is $8 - 4 = 4$. (Add 4)
  • From H to N: The difference in positional value is $14 - 8 = 6$. (Add 6)

The pattern observed in BDHN is adding 2, then 4, then 6 to the positional values: +2, +4, +6.

2. ZAEJ

  • Z is the 26th letter.
  • A is the 1st letter.
  • E is the 5th letter.
  • J is the 10th letter.

Let's check the difference between consecutive letters, considering the alphabet wraps around (cyclic):

  • From Z to A: Z is 26, A is 1. Moving from Z to A cyclically is like adding 1 (26 $\xrightarrow{+1}$ 27, and 27 corresponds to A after Z). Add 1.
  • From A to E: The difference in positional value is $5 - 1 = 4$. (Add 4)
  • From E to J: The difference in positional value is $10 - 5 = 5$. (Add 5)

The pattern observed in ZAEJ is adding 1, then 4, then 5 to the positional values: +1, +4, +5.

3. WYCI

  • W is the 23rd letter.
  • Y is the 25th letter.
  • C is the 3rd letter.
  • I is the 9th letter.

Let's check the difference between consecutive letters, considering cyclic nature:

  • From W to Y: The difference in positional value is $25 - 23 = 2$. (Add 2)
  • From Y to C: Y is 25, C is 3. Moving from Y to C cyclically is like adding 4 (25 $\xrightarrow{+4}$ 29, and 29 corresponds to C after Y). Add 4.
  • From C to I: The difference in positional value is $9 - 3 = 6$. (Add 6)

The pattern observed in WYCI is adding 2, then 4, then 6 to the positional values: +2, +4, +6.

4. HJNT

  • H is the 8th letter.
  • J is the 10th letter.
  • N is the 14th letter.
  • T is the 20th letter.

Let's check the difference between consecutive letters:

  • From H to J: The difference in positional value is $10 - 8 = 2$. (Add 2)
  • From J to N: The difference in positional value is $14 - 10 = 4$. (Add 4)
  • From N to T: The difference in positional value is $20 - 14 = 6$. (Add 6)

The pattern observed in HJNT is adding 2, then 4, then 6 to the positional values: +2, +4, +6.

Identifying the Different Letter Cluster

Let's summarize the patterns we found:

Letter ClusterPattern (Difference in Positional Value)
BDHN+2, +4, +6
ZAEJ+1, +4, +5
WYCI+2, +4, +6 (with cyclic wrap)
HJNT+2, +4, +6

Three of the letter clusters (BDHN, WYCI, HJNT) follow the pattern of adding +2, +4, and +6 to the positional values of the letters, with cyclic movement applied when necessary (as seen in WYCI). The letter cluster ZAEJ follows a different pattern of adding +1, +4, and +5.

Therefore, ZAEJ is the letter-cluster that is different from the others.

Additional Information on Letter Series and Odd One Out Questions

Questions involving finding the odd one out among letter clusters or series are common in reasoning tests. They assess your ability to identify patterns and logical sequences. Understanding the different types of patterns is key to solving these problems efficiently.

Common patterns used in letter series and odd one out questions include:

  • Positional Value Differences: Adding or subtracting a constant value, or a sequence of values (like arithmetic progression: +2, +4, +6).
  • Cyclic Patterns: Considering the alphabet as a cycle where A follows Z.
  • Skipping Letters: Skipping a fixed number of letters or a varying number of letters between consecutive terms.
  • Vowel/Consonant Patterns: Based on the position or presence of vowels or consonants.
  • Combination of Rules: A mix of different logic applied sequentially.

To improve your skills in this area, practice identifying the positional values of letters quickly and systematically test common patterns like arithmetic differences, skipping letters, and cyclic movement.
